"An Introduction to Radio Astronomy" by Bernard F. Burke, Francis Graham-Smith, Peter N. Wilkinson is a astronomy book and space science reference focused on Equipment & Methods. Best for students, researchers, and serious astronomy enthusiasts.
A thorough introduction to radio astronomy and techniques for students and researchers approaching radio astronomy for the first time.
